Nouveautés réglementaires de la zone
Modification of daily catch limit for char: 10 in all, with a maximum of 2 Arctic char. Complete closure of landlocked salmon fishing in rivière Montmorency from the base of chute Montmorency to the north side of the route 138 right-of-way. Modification of Atlantic salmon fishing season in the rivière Malbaie between the downstream side of the route 138 bridge and the downstream side of the railway crossing in Clermont: advanced to June 1. Modification of the fishing season for all species except striped bass and Atlantic salmon in rivière Petit Saguenay between the mouth of the river and the bridge on chemin des Chutes: closes September 15. Modification of the daily catch limit for Atlantic salmon in rivière Petit Saguenay between the mouth of the river and the bridge on chemin des Chutes: 0 retained and no more than 3 caught and released.
